Normative Reference Database of Spectral Domain Optical Coherence Tomography for Korean Population
Yoon Jung-Suk

Jeong Jae-Hoon
Abstract
Purpose : To establish a normative reference database more suitable for Korean population by compensating racial differences of the commercially available spectral domain-optical coherence tomography (SD-OCT) database.

Methods : Three hundred twenty healthy eyes, range of 20-85 years, of Korean population were enrolled in the single center, prospective study. The optic nerve and macular parameters were measured with HOCT-1F (Huvitz, Anyang, Korea) certified by the Ministry of Food and Drug Safety.

Results : The distribution by age was 20s 54 eyes, 30s 59 eyes, 40s 65 eyes, 50s 66 eyes, 60s 41 eyes, and over 70s 35 eyes. The mean age was 47.5 years, 154 eyes (48%) were male, and 166 eyes (52%) were female. The measurements by HOCT-1F were: vertical cup to disc (C/D) ratio 0.6, C/D ratio area 0.37, retinal nerve fiber layer (RNFL) thickness 101.6 ¥ìm, total macular thickness 289.4 ¥ìm and central macular thickness 241.5 ¥ìm. RNFL thickness and average total macular thickness had a negative correlation with increasing age. Average total macular thickness was significantly thicker in men than women.

Conclusions : A reference database specialized for Koreans was created using a recently developed SD-OCT. Most of the results showed a similar tendency with previous studies in normal Korean population and confirmed some differences between parameters according to age or sex. Therefore, these results can be represented as a reference database of normal Korean eyes, and it is expected to improve the diagnostic accuracy of SD-OCT as a reference more suitable for Koreans.
